.shop-phone {
  float: left;
  color: #fff;
  padding: 11px 10px 11px 0px;
  line-height: 18px; }
  @media (min-width: 768px) and (max-width: 991px) {
    .shop-phone {
      display: none; } }
  .shop-phone i {
    font-size: 21px;
    line-height: 14px;
    color: #fff;
    position: relative;
    top: 3px;
    padding-right: 7px; }
  .shop-phone strong a,
  .shop-phone strong {
    color: #fff; }
  .shop-phone:hover i,
  .shop-phone:hover strong a,
  .shop-phone:hover strong {
    color: #fff;
  }

 /* @media (max-width: 991px) {
    .shop-phone.is_logged {
      display: none; } }*/

#contact-link {
  float: right;
 }
  @media (max-width: 479px) {
    #contact-link {
      text-align: center; } }
  #contact-link a {
    display: block;
    color: #fff;
    padding: 11px 10px 11px 10px;
    cursor: pointer;
    line-height: 18px; }
    #contact-link:hover a {
      color: #fff;
    }
    
    #contact-link a:hover, #contact-link a.active {}
  

@media (max-width: 767px) {
  #contact_block {
    margin-bottom: 20px; } }
#contact_block .label {
  display: none; }
#contact_block .block_content {
  color: #888888; }
#contact_block p {
  margin-bottom: 4px; }
#contact_block p.tel {
  color: #333;
  margin-bottom: 6px; }
  #contact_block p.tel i {
    font-size: 25px;
    vertical-align: -2px;
    padding-right: 10px; }

/*# sourceMappingURL=blockcontact.css.map */
